吴晓栋
- 技术能力:
- 工作态度:
- 工作成果:
项目意向
940元
全程集中
-
工作经验:
擅长技能:
C#、C++
平台工作经历
其他工作经历
公司名称
在北京天融信科技有限公司
在职时间
2009-11-01 ~ 2019-01-01
职位名称
薪水
0/月
项目描述
个人职责
①、负责产品领域最新技术的研究以及发展方向的把控,并制定相应的产品方案。
②、从事底层安全研究和开发。
③、领域内前沿技术跟踪与研究。
使用技能
无
公司名称
任职北京飞天诚信科技有限公司。
在职时间
2006-09-01 ~ 2009-10-01
职位名称
薪水
0/月
项目描述
个人职责
①、负责编写和维护公司产品(软件加密锁、身份认证锁)的驱动程序,都是USB接口设备;以及文件系统驱动程序的开发;
②、负责公司所有驱动在WINDOWS 2K/XP/VISTA下的32/64位Windows Logo Program签名测试;
③、以公司产品方向为核心,对当前国内外产品和前沿技术进行研究和分析,并为公司提出相应的产品方案和产品发展规划;
④、对RootKit技术进行深入的研究和分析;
⑤、负责软件加密技术前沿技术研究与DEMO的开发。
使用技能
无
公司名称
任职北京软通科技有限公司研发部核心组。
在职时间
2004-09-01 ~ 2006-09-01
职位名称
③、对INTEL VT虚拟机技术有整体的认识和探索,并在此基础上深入研读了LINUX/UNIX内核中的VFS及驱动开发,尝试在LINUX下开发一个具有多级恢复功能的文件系统;
薪水
0/月
项目描述
项目管理/项目协调
个人职责
①、主要从事文件系统过滤驱动IFS、磁盘过滤驱动、防火墙及NDIS网络过滤驱动的开发;
②、实现磁盘数据的备份与恢复,对WINDOWS操作系统的的体系结构及内核组件有深刻的认识和挖掘,能够深刻地把握它的设计思想和运行机制;
④、磁盘全盘加解密,采用MBR、WINDOWS文件系统驱动/磁盘驱动和控制界面三层架构实现,该项目由本人一人完成;
⑤、利用驱动程序对软盘、光驱、USB大容量存储设备、1394、红外等设备进行使用和读写控制;
⑥、尝试裁剪LINUX或在WIN PE的基础定制一个进行系统维护和安全防护的安全操作系统PRE OS。
采用的开发工具为VC/MFC、C/C++、IFS DDK、LINUX内核。能熟练使用VC.NET进行应用、网络通讯和多媒本开发。另外,对C#和ASP.NET有所掌握,曾使用该工具进行过法律库项目的开发。
四、 2003年5月至2004年9月 任职于深圳顶星数码网络技术有限公司笔记本研发部软件处。
①、负责WINDOWS驱动程序及应用程序这一块,主要为BIOS和EC提供与DDK相关问题的解决方案和知识,使用下层的DDK配合上层的应用程序打造笔记本特有的硬件特性和专有功能;
②、利用ACPI驱动为用户定制一个具有特色的操作界面,如笔记本的控制中心;
③、曾对挂在PCI总线下的一个温度控测硬件设备作过一个物理驱动;
④、编写各种测试程序,如端口测试、CPU温度和频率、风扇速度、获取电池信息、软件超频等等。
⑤、修改MBR,在系统自举时获得控制权,并对USB主机控制器进行初始化和读写操作。
所涉及到的知识有DDK、BIOS、EMBEDDED CONTROLER、计算机体系结构、主板的组织与架构、ACPI规范及各种总线协议(PCI、LPC、USB、ATAPI、CARD BUS、1394、AGP等)。采用的开发工具为VC/MFC、C/C++和X86汇编语言。
使用技能
无
公司名称
在珠海金山软件公司毒霸事业部引擎组工作。
在职时间
2000-07-01 ~ 2003-05-01
职位名称
薪水
0/月
项目描述
个人职责
①、主要从事计算机病毒的分析、查找及提出相应的解决方案;
②、磁盘数据恢复;
③、应用程序界面的设计开发工作;
④、磁盘工具开发。
所涉及的知识有X86CPU的工作方式和指令系统、PC中断调用、磁盘数据结构、FAT16/32文件系统、DOS及WINDOWS操作系统内核及其体系结构、内核组件和运行机制以及该操作系统下应用程序的运行机制、计算机病毒分析与防治等。使用的开发工具和程序语言为VC、C/C++和X86汇编。
计算机专业水平:
在这10多年的实际工作中,我不断地学习、探索和极力提高自己的专业水平,就现在,我仔细审视自己,认为自己在技术方面具有和掌握以下专业知识。
1、深谙计算机的思想、原理及其运行机制,对计算机的原理和本质有一套自己独到的见解和理论体系,目前正在按自己的设想进行实际地实现过程中。
2、对CPU的三种工作方式(实方式、V86方式和保护方式)、运行机制和指令系统有很深的研究和探索;以及由CPU为核心而向外扩展的存储器、总线控制器、电桥、适配器和I/O设备之间的搭配,如何进行数据传输和控制的真谛深有领悟;并由此对如何进行数据传输而产生的各种总线及其规范和协议也有基本的了解。如ACPI软协议,以及PCI、USB、AGP、SCSI、SMBUS、CARDBUS、PCMCIA 、ISA、LPC、1394、串口、并口等硬件总线协议。
3、对WINDOWS操作系统的体系结构、内核组件、运行原理及设计思想有一定的领悟,对操作系统我也有自己独特的见解和认识。清楚WINDOWS操作系统下最下层的硬件到最上的应用层各层的关系及功能;对于WINDOWS操作系统中处于内核模式的I/O管理器中的设备驱动程序及其它内核组件如PNP管理器、电源管理器、配套管理器、对象管理器、内核、内存管理器等有全面的了解,对DDK有深入地掌握。对处于用户层的WINDOWS应用程序的运行机制、进程、线程、消息等有深入的了解。
4、了解FAT16/32文件系统,清楚磁盘数据结构,掌握磁盘数据恢复的基本原理和方法。
5、熟练掌握以下开发语言和工具: IFS DDK、C/C++、VC/MFC、DOS/WINDOWS下汇编,对C#和.NET也深有掌握,曾用该工具进行过项目开发。
6、对电子学和硬件有一个基本、系统的认识和掌握,曾尝试用触发器设计一台不用时钟的处理器,采用线性的工作方式,用VHDL语言生成电路,然后烧到FPGA里运行。
7、对任何一个专业知识或问题能迅速掌握其关键点,并能提出有效的创新性想法。
本人的不足及缺点:
我在英语和数学上存在着一定的差距,目前我正在这方面努力地提高自己。
本人优点:
我感觉自己正直、诚实、可信,最大的特点是非常勤奋好学,具有很强的学习能力,并具有强烈的求知欲望,能在较短的时间内掌握一个知识要点;对事物有深刻的洞察能力和领悟能力,并具有超常的创新思维,对一个问题能迅速地把握其本质,最具有对一个事物寻根溯源、深度理解的思维习惯。
个人性格:
我自己认为的特点以及别人对我的共同认识是,朴实、正直、温和、勤奋好学。确实,我的确也认为自己勤奋好学,并且注重方法和效率,因为我把勤奋好学作为我的生存之本、立足之根。另外,我对音乐和我国的古典文学,如唐诗、宋词、元曲和明清的小说都是非常地热爱。本人认为自己的缺点有: 不善于交际、沟通能力不很强。
使用技能
无
教育经历
